Thanks to a lake’s DNA analysis tool, Quebecers will soon be able to know in real time if their lake is contaminated by blue-green algae.

Should we avoid swimming when an episode of cyanobacteria (blue-green algae) is observed? However, Currently, many residents do not know on what foot dancing, because the ministry analyzes, when there are, take time.

“The way to detect cyanobacteria. For example, in the laboratory, is really long, it is done under a microscope and it takes four days so it is too late to intervene,” explains Stéphanie Lord-Fontaine, vice-president of Genome Quebec.

At Lake Maskinongé. Therefore, in Lanaudière, each episode of cyanobacteria leads to the complete or partial closure of the municipal beach. Less surveillance

Since 2018, surveillance of cyanobacteria in Quebec has been reduced to the bare minimum. The ministry no longer publishes an annual assessment and does not systematically move in the field.

For the year 2024-2025. despite 197 reports, only seven bodies of water were inspected and four cases of cyanobacteria efflorescences were confirmed.

In comparison. in 2007, 275 lakes had been inspected and efflorescences of cyanobacteria had been reported for 167 of them, according to data from the ministry.

The answer in DNA

A pilot project from the National Institute for Scientific Research (INRS). Laval University could change the situation. Researcher Jérôme “a pea soup water”: quick Comte has developed a tool capable of detecting cyanobacteria from a simple DNA sample in just a. few hours. Mr. Comte’s team is currently working on improving toxins analyzes in different cyanobacteria.

Thanks to the financial support of the non -profit scientific organization genome Quebec. the technology made it possible to analyze, reliably, the state of 20 lakes last year.

“It’s like a big USB key. we bring it to the field, we prepare our water sample then we pass it in the machine on the ground and it takes three hours,” explains Mme Lord-Fontaine.

He hopes to sample a hundred lakes this summer. The project will continue until September 2026.

For its part. the Ministry of the Environment, which collaborates in the project by providing samples, is cautious.

“It is an ambitious project. there are still many works to be carried out before the [ministère] Evaluates the possibility of using this new technology for the analysis of routine cyanobacteria, “said Josée Guimond, to the Communications Department of the Ministry of the Environment.
